Sec. 5. (a) If the proper officers of a political subdivision desire to appropriate more money for a particular year than the amount prescribed in the budget for that year as finally determined under this article, they shall give notice of their proposed additional appropriation. The notice shall state the time and place at which a public hearing will be held on the proposal. The notice shall be given once in accordance with IC 5-3-1-2(b).

     (b) If the additional appropriation by the political subdivision is made from a fund for which the budget, rate, or levy is certified by the department of local government finance under IC 6-1.1-17-16, the political subdivision must report the additional appropriation to the department of local government finance in the manner prescribed by the department of local government finance. If the additional appropriation is made from a fund described under this subsection, subsections (f), (g), (h), and (i) apply to the political subdivision.

     (c) However, if the additional appropriation is not made from a fund described under subsection (b), subsections (f), (g), (h), and (i) do not apply to the political subdivision. Subsections (f), (g), (h), and (i) do not apply to an additional appropriation made from the cumulative bridge fund if the appropriation meets the requirements under IC 8-16-3-3(c).

     (d) A political subdivision may make an additional appropriation without approval of the department of local government finance if the additional appropriation is made from a fund that is not described under subsection (b). However, the fiscal officer of the political subdivision shall report the additional appropriation to the department of local government finance.

     (e) Subject to subsections (j) and (k), after the public hearing, the proper officers of the political subdivision shall file a certified copy of their final proposal and any other relevant information to the department of local government finance not later than fifteen (15) days after the additional appropriation is adopted by the appropriate fiscal body. If the additional appropriation is not submitted to the department of local government finance within fifteen (15) days after adoption, the department of local government finance may require the political subdivision to conduct a readoption hearing.

     (f) When the department of local government finance receives a certified copy of a proposal for an additional appropriation under subsection (e), the department shall determine whether sufficient funds are available or will be available for the proposal. The determination shall be made in writing and sent to the political subdivision not more than fifteen (15) days after the department of local government finance receives the proposal.

     (g) In making the determination under subsection (f), the department of local government finance shall limit the amount of the additional appropriation to revenues available, or to be made available, which have not been previously appropriated.

     (h) If the department of local government finance disapproves an additional appropriation under subsection (f), the department shall specify the reason for its disapproval on the determination sent to the political subdivision.

     (i) A political subdivision may request a reconsideration of a determination of the department of local government finance under this section by filing a written request for reconsideration. A request for reconsideration must:

(1) be filed with the department of local government finance within fifteen (15) days of the receipt of the determination by the political subdivision; and

(2) state with reasonable specificity the reason for the request.

The department of local government finance must act on a request for reconsideration within fifteen (15) days of receiving the request.

     (j) This subsection applies to an additional appropriation by a political subdivision that must have the political subdivision’s annual appropriations and annual tax levy adopted by a city, town, or county fiscal body under IC 6-1.1-17-20 or IC 36-1-23 or by a legislative or fiscal body under IC 36-3-6-9. The fiscal or legislative body of the city, town, or county that adopted the political subdivision’s annual appropriation and annual tax levy must adopt the additional appropriation by ordinance before the department of local government finance may approve the additional appropriation.

     (k) This subsection applies to a public library that is not required to submit the public library’s budgets, tax rates, and tax levies for binding review and approval under IC 6-1.1-17-20 or IC 6-1.1-17-20.4. If a public library subject to this subsection proposes to make an additional appropriation for a year, and the additional appropriation would result in the budget for the library for that year increasing (as compared to the previous year) by a percentage that is greater than the result of the maximum levy growth quotient determined under IC 6-1.1-18.5-2 for the calendar year minus one (1), the additional appropriation must first be approved by the city, town, or county fiscal body described in IC 6-1.1-17-20.3(c) or IC 6-1.1-17-20.3(d), as appropriate.

     (l) This subsection applies to an appropriation for which the underlying purpose is a bond issue. The political subdivision shall include the appropriation for the bond proceeds in the budget of the political subdivision for the ensuing year adopted under IC 6-1.1-17. If the political subdivision does not include the appropriation for the bond proceeds as required by this subsection, the political subdivision shall comply with the requirements of this section in the year in which the bond proceeds are received, but may not take an action pursuant to this section in a year before the year in which the bond proceeds are received.
